Durability and Long life



When it pertains to longevity and durability, the selection in between asphalt shingles and metal roof covering can considerably impact the lifespan of your roofing system. Metal roofing has a tendency to have a longer life-span compared to asphalt shingles. Metal roofs can last 40-70 years or more, while asphalt tiles generally last around 20-30 years. Metal roof is known for its resistance to severe climate condition such as heavy rainfall, snow, hailstorm, and high winds. Additionally, metal roofs are fireproof and do not rot or develop mold, making them a durable selection for your home.

On the other hand, asphalt tiles are more vulnerable to harm from extreme climate, which can bring about the demand for even more frequent repair work or replacements.


While asphalt shingles are at first extra cost effective than steel roof, the long-lasting expenses of upkeep and replacements can add up. Consequently, if resilience and longevity are your top priorities, buying a steel roofing might be a much more cost-effective alternative in the future.

Cost and Upkeep



In considering cost and maintenance, the economic elements of selecting between asphalt roof shingles and metal roof play a crucial duty in your decision-making process.

Asphalt shingles are normally extra budget-friendly ahead of time, making them a popular option for budget-conscious property owners. However, it's important to factor in long-term upkeep costs. Asphalt roof shingles may need more frequent repair services and replacements due to deterioration from weather.

On the other hand, while steel roof has a greater first cost, it's known for its longevity and durability, requiring minimal upkeep over its life expectancy. This might lead to expense savings in the long run as you won't have to fret about consistently replacing your roof covering. Looks and Energy Effectiveness



To enhance the visual charm of your home and make the most of power efficiency, the aesthetics and energy effectiveness of your roof material are key factors to consider. When it concerns visual appeals, asphalt shingles provide a typical look that can complement different building designs. They come in a variety of colors and structures, allowing you to tailor the appearance of your roofing.

On the other hand, steel roof covering provides a contemporary and sleek visual that can provide your home a modern feeling. Its smooth surface and clean lines can include a touch of elegance to your property.

In regards to power effectiveness, metal roof covering often tends to outmatch asphalt roof shingles. Steel shows the sunlight's rays, lowering heat transfer into your home and assisting to reduced air conditioning costs during heat. Furthermore, steel roofs are frequently made from recycled products and can be recycled at the end of their life expectancy, making them a more environmentally friendly choice. Take into consideration both aesthetic appeals and power efficiency when choosing in between asphalt tiles and steel roof covering for your home.
